In the Spirit World was where Soana had settled. She grew thankful of the spirits and how kind they were to her when she first came.

Not only did she have the spirit's favor, but she also gained another friend after a few years of being there; Iroh. When arriving in the first place, Iroh looked weak but with time he had gathered enough strength to become a strong spirit like Soana.

Although Soana was no longer young, she still had the look of youth for being 45 at the time of her death. Her face had smile lines and her hair had turned from dark brown to a beige color from years of stress and experience as the President of the United Republic.

Even after her death, Republic City still needed work. Even after Avatar Aang's death, Avatar Korra came in to help build the city back to its richest. During her time, she opened the spirit portal in the North and South Poles which gave access for spirits to come and go into the real world as they pleased.

Not only were spirits allowed to enter the human realm, but humans could enter the spirit world as they pleased.

So one day when Soana and Iroh were peacefully playing Pai Sho with several dragonfly bunny spirits flying around them, entertained by the game, they noticed someone had entered the spirit portal and was approaching them from the woodland area nearby.

Soana sighed, feeling pleased and at ease as she was the moment she had entered the spirit world.

"We got company, Iroh." Soana informed, feeling a dragonfly bunny landing on her shoulder.

She giggled, feeling their fluffy face rubbing against her temple.

Iroh chuckled.
"I know. I can feel their footsteps growing close."

Although Soana was at ease, the impatient side of her appeared when she could see the silhouette.

"Someone tall, and old." Soana informed.

Iroh held a smile, getting up from the sitting position on the ground.
"It's someone we both know."

Steadily, Iroh walked towards the silhouette who was now illuminated with the light that was shining onto the meadow they were in.

"Uncle." Soana heard a raspy, old voice speak.

She turned and took in the man's appearance. He was in Fire Nation clothing and his hair was long and white along with his beard. Nothing about him was familiar until Soana gaze upon the left side of his face to see a scar.

"Zuko." She said to herself as she stood up from the Pai Sho table, making the dragonfly bunnies disperse.

She watched as he two old men embraced each other in a hug. They held each other right before they pulled away and looked at each other.

Iroh cocked his head and sighed.
"You're not only here for me."

He then moved to the side to reveal Soana to Zuko.

Though Soana was at peace, she felt more content than she did before now that Zuko was now standing before her.

As the former Fire Lord gawked at her, his face fell and tears grew along his waterline. He couldn't believe she was there standing before him.

She took multiple strides towards him before she placed her hands on his shoulders. Although he appeared to be saddened, she could sense his joy deep within.

"Soana," Zuko gasped before he wrapped his arms around her waist, seizing her in his embrace.

He released a shaky breath before she ran her hands through his white hair.

"You're old and gray." She giggled.

"I know." He trembled.

She rubbed his back as they both pulled away. Suddenly, she frowned at what was before her.

"Zuko,"

Soana paused, seeing that his wrinkled face was no longer wrinkled. His hair wasn't long and white, and his beard was gone.

He was young again, possibly at the age of seventeen.

She furrowed her brows as she glanced at Iroh.

Iroh beamed.
"You're the ages you were when you both were at your prime."

"Yes, but I thought only spirits could do that." Soana informed.

Zuko sighed deeply.
"Soana,"

She let her gaze fall back to him.
"You're not here visiting, are you?"

Zuko's lips curved as he shook his head.
"No. I'm here to stay."

The corners of her lips pulled as they both beamed at each other. She giggled as she noticed Zuko's face getting closer. She seized her laughter and meet Zuko in the middle before their lips pressed together, feeling safe and sound in his arms again.

As they shared a tender moment, the spirits from nearby gathered around and stared at the couple before Iroh turned and shared a pleased grin.

"He's here to stay!" He announced, making the spirits erupt in cheers and shouts.

The dragonfly bunnies from earlier flew around in circles as they whizzed cheerfully.

As Zuko and Soana pulled away, they gazed into one another's eyes.

She placed her palm on his cheekbone and whispered.
"I love you."

He responded quickly.
"I love you the most."
